Description / Scope of Work
SSGC Procurement Department invites sealed bids from eligible contractors for the procurement of a PABX telephone exchange system for the Regional Office at Nawabshah in Sindh province. The procurement is funded under FY 2026-27 budget allocation with reference P94069 and will be conducted through single-stage, one-envelope bidding using the Least Cost Based Selection technique in accordance with the Public Procurement Rules 2004. The scope covers supply and installation of the PABX system as specified in the technical requirements document.
Bidders must be registered on EPADS v2.0 and must submit bids electronically through the e-Pak Acquisition and Disposal System. Bid security is required in the form of pay order, call deposit, bank guarantee, or bid securing declaration as specified in the bidding documents. All bids must comply with eligibility criteria outlined in the tender documents and meet the specified technical and commercial requirements for the PABX installation.
Electronic bids must be submitted through EPADS v2.0 on or before Friday, September 25, 2026 at 10:00 AM, with bid opening scheduled for the same day at 10:30 AM.
